In short: Best value run in London: cracking low key small numbers race
In full: Friendly race this one. Numbers are few but all are friendly people (organisers and runners).

The pathway is pretty poor due to potholes so beware, but the scenery is excellent with no obstacles.

Quite flat race with little slope but no hills so good.

I really enjoyed it.

Would do it again.

In short: Very easy simple and enjoyable race course.
In full: This is a good course. Flat, simple, wide roads, no hills and good water stations. Friendly, easy to get to and nice stewards. I enjoyed it.

Not challenging which is a nice change but all will enjoy it. Good variety of runners.

Sadly no goody bags or medals, just water & bananas at the end, but it's cheap so who cares?

A good fun race well managed.

In short: Big name & numbers race, crowded but much fun.
In full: It's a good race, but problem is that it can be too busy. Lots of water stations is a plus (esp as it was really hot this year). I like smaller number races (upto 500) but it was still fun here, around 25k runners. One huge problem is that the markings for each km were not always visible (or I just missed them). Only gripe is that one really. Organisations is fine... I liked it but prefer more personable races than the giant number ones.

In short: Nice well organised race... Very standard....
In full: A well organised and enjoyable race. Mixture of road, track and grass running. Friendly place and race was split into 5k & 10k races.

Track is generally flat but a small short hill part around 3k/8k which is manageable and won't stop anyone in their tracks. No obstacles or car traffic which is a welcome relief.

Also very easy to get to.

Nice medal at end and choccy bar too.

I liked it... Give it a shot.

In short: Very mixed terrain race, and mind the traffic!!!!!
In full: Lots of good and bad things to say of this race. Very friendly place and stewards were nice. Anyhow, this hill starts on grass, then pavement (very tight with no space so running is hampered) then long uphill shallow), then long uphill steep, then onto unsteady grass mounds and so on...

Very mixed course.

~Difficult to make a good time sadly due to some of the problems.

Worst is that some roads etc should have been shut off as there was serious problem of potential being knocked down. Stewards did okay but they need help on this.

I enjoyed it, and setting was nice.

Just need to iron out some bits and all is good.

Medal was excellent quality! Drinks etc at end were great too.
